Do You Need Glasses Mountain Biking?

If you’re an avid mountain biker, you may have asked yourself, “Do I need glasses mountain biking?” The answer is yes; in fact, it’s highly recommended to wear glasses while mountain biking. Not only do they protect your eyes from debris and dust, but they can also improve vision while riding.

Protection. Wearing glasses while mountain biking is important for protecting your eyes from dirt, dust, and other debris that can cause irritation and injury.

Depending on the terrain you are riding on, your eyes can be subject to all kinds of flying objects like rocks and sticks. Wearing a pair of protective glasses will keep your eyes safe from these hazards.

Improved Vision. Another benefit of wearing glasses while mountain biking is improved vision.

Many riders find that wearing tinted lenses helps them see better in bright sunlight or during a stormy day when visibility is low. They also help reduce the glare from the sun which can make it difficult to see clearly when riding in direct sunlight. In addition to this, some riders prefer to wear prescription lenses to help correct any vision problems they may have.

Comfort. Finally, wearing glasses while mountain biking provides an additional layer of comfort as well as protection.

By wearing a comfortable pair of glasses with adjustable arms and nose pads, you can ensure that your glasses won’t slip off even during intense rides or jumps. This added layer of comfort means that you won’t be distracted by constantly having to adjust your eyewear mid-ride.

Conclusion: In conclusion, it is highly recommended for mountain bikers to wear protective glasses while riding. Not only do they provide protection from dirt and debris but also improved visibility and comfort during rides. Whether you opt for tinted lenses or prescription lenses depends on your individual needs but either way, wearing eyewear will ensure that your ride is safe and enjoyable.
